boostrap模态框笔记

<div class="modal fade bs-example-modal" id="modal" tabindex="-1" role="dialog" aria-labelledby="myModalLabel" aria-hidden="true">
    <div class="modal-dialog modal-lg">
        <div class="modal-content">
            <div class="modal-header">
                <button type="button" class="close" data-dismiss="modal" aria-hidden="true">×</button>
                <h4 class="modal-title" id="myModalLabel">
                    模态框标题
                </h4>
            </div>
            <div class="modal-body">
                <div class="form-horizontal" role="form">
                    <input type="hidden" id="id" name="id" />
                    <div class="form-group">
                        <label for="robotId" class="col-sm-2 control-label">机器人编号</label>
                        <div class="col-sm-6">
                            <input type="text" class="form-control" id="robotId" name="robotId" style="border:none"  readonly>
                        </div>
                    </div>
                 ...
                    <div class="form-group">
                        <label for="robotDescription" class="col-sm-2 control-label">描述</label>
                        <div class="col-sm-6">
                            <input type="text" class="form-control" id="robotDescription" name="robotDescription" style="border:none" readonly>
                        </div>
                    </div>

                </div>
            </div>

            <div class="modal-footer">
                <button type="button" class="btn btn-default"  data-dismiss="modal">关闭</button>
       <button type="button" class="btn btn-primary" id="submit">提交</button>
           </div>
        </div><!-- /.modal-content -->
    </div><!-- /.modal-dialog -->
</div><!-- /.modal -->
js:
//初始化模态窗口
$('#modal').modal({
    backdrop: false,//指定一个静态的背景,当用户点击模态框外部时不会关闭模态框。
    show: false,//true 初始化的时候显示模态框,false 方法调用再显示
    keyboard: true //指定一个静态的背景,当用户点击模态框外部时不会关闭模态框。
//添加按钮绑定事件 )}

    //添加
$("#add").on("click", function() {
    $("#id").val("");
    $("#modalLabel").html("添加"); //动态修改模态框标题
    clearModalForm();
    $("#modal").modal("show"); //显示模态框
});
//模态框表单提交
$("#submit").on("click", function() {
    save();
});
});
function save() {
    var  id = $("#id").val();
    var intent = $("#intent").val();
    var applyCaseType= $("#applyCaseType").val();
    var questionElem =$("#questionElem").val();
    var clarifyId =$("#clarifyId").val();
    var clarifyStatement=  $("#clarifyStatement").val();
    var answerWordSlot = $("#slotCode").val();
    var answerInputType = $("#answerInputType").val();
    var mergeTree = $("#mergeTree").val();
    if(mergeTree==''){
        mergeTree=true;
    }
    var branchRule = $("#branchRule").val();
    var syntheticTemplate=$("#syntheticTemplate").val();
    var answerCode = $("#answerCode").val();
    var  coverParenTeplate= $("#teplate  input[name='coverParenTeplate']:checked").val();
    $.ajax({
        url: URLObject.saveOrUpdateBtn,
        type: "post",
        async: false,
        data: {
            id: id,
            syntheticTemplate : syntheticTemplate,
            answerCode : answerCode,
            coverParenTeplate :coverParenTeplate
        },
        success: function(resp) {
            var data = resp;
            if(data.flag == 1 || data.flag == "1") {
                WinAlert.jAlert("提示", data.msg, function() {
                    countDiv=1;
                    $("#modal").modal("hide"); //保存后隐藏事件
                    clearModalForm();
                    $("#table").bootstrapTable("refresh");
                });
            } else {
                WinAlert.jAlertError("操作失败", data.msg);
            }
        },
        error: function(err) {
        }
    });
}


  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值